FCC Bans Robots
  • On July 31 2026, the Federal Communications Commission announced a ban on importing and selling robotic devices such as vacuums and lawn mowers in United States.
  • Critics say the rule favors country of origin over security, stifling innovation, raising prices, and ignoring cybersecurity standards.
  • The ban judges robots only by manufacturing location, not by cybersecurity assessment.
  • Only the U.S.-assembled Matic vacuum, using imported parts, will cost $1,495 versus $300 models.
